Tobi Lütke, the CEO of Canadian e-commerce company Shopify, was quick to announce a permanent switch to remote work. In May, he tweeted, “We will keep our offices closed until 2021 so that we can rework them for this new reality. Office centricity is over.” The company is also running an experiment to learn more about the effect of teleworking on energy usage and carbon emissions. When it was clear that COVID would become a pandemic in the U.S. in March of 2020, Upwork’s offices in San Francisco, Santa Clara, Calif., and Chicago shut down completely. Just two months later, the company announced that they had become permanently remote, with an option to work from the office for people who wanted to. In October 2020, they closed the Santa Clara office owing to a reduced need for in-person meeting spaces.

Before the pandemic, almost all of Upwork’s freelancers (which make up 75% of its workforce) worked remotely, but only around 10% of full-time employees were remote. Now, 100% of their team operates remotely, employees and freelancers alike, with the option to work in an office should they choose to.
